Adria Airways brand up for sale

In line with the invitation, published on the web site of the national Agency for Public Legal Records and Related Services at the end of last week, only bids with a security deposit of EUR 15,000 will be considered.

Pustatičnik committed to informing all bidders of the outcome within 15 days after the deadline for bids expires.

Bidders will not be able to physically review documents related to the brand until restrictions imposed in the coronavirus epidemic are lifted. If the situation does not change until 6 July, the deadline will be extended.

Adria Airways has been in receivership since October 2019.

Its bankruptcy estate has been estimated at EUR 6.2 million, more than half of which is represented by the title to its office building at Ljubljana airport. Other valuable assets include the brand, a flight simulator and a share in Adria's flight school.

In late January, the air carrier's operating licences were auctioned off for EUR 45,000 to Air Adriatic, a firm recently incorporated by Slovenian produce importer Izet Rastoder.
